How To Fix /SCWM/WHO520 - Specified WT &1 is not part of warehouse order &2


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: /SCWM/WHO -

  • Message number: 520

  • Message text: Specified WT &1 is not part of warehouse order &2

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message /SCWM/WHO520 - Specified WT &1 is not part of warehouse order &2 ?

    The SAP error message /SCWM/WHO520 indicates that a specified Warehouse Task (WT) is not part of the Warehouse Order (WO) you are trying to process. This error typically occurs in the context of SAP Extended Warehouse Management (EWM) when there is an attempt to perform an operation on a Warehouse Task that is not associated with the specified Warehouse Order.

    Cause:

    1. Incorrect WT Reference: The Warehouse Task you are trying to reference does not belong to the Warehouse Order you are working with. This can happen if the WT was created for a different WO or if it has been deleted or modified.
    2. Data Consistency Issues: There may be inconsistencies in the data, such as if the Warehouse Task was changed after the Warehouse Order was created.
    3. User Error: The user may have mistakenly entered the wrong WT or WO numbers.

    Solution:

    1. Verify WT and WO Association: Check the association between the Warehouse Task and the Warehouse Order. You can do this by navigating to the relevant transactions in SAP EWM and confirming that the WT is indeed part of the specified WO.
    2. Check for Deletions or Modifications: Ensure that the WT has not been deleted or modified after the WO was created. If it has, you may need to recreate the WT or adjust the WO accordingly.
    3. Use Correct WT: If you have the wrong WT, find the correct one that is associated with the WO you are trying to process.
    4. Review Logs and Messages: Check the system logs or messages for any additional information that might indicate why the WT is not recognized as part of the WO.
    5.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or help resources for further guidance on handling Warehouse Tasks and Orders.

    Related Information:

    • Transaction Codes: You may use transaction codes like /SCWM/ORDIM (for managing warehouse orders) or /SCWM/PRDI (for managing warehouse tasks) to investigate the issue further.
